Last
month, I talked about Longman
Cornerstone (grades K-5) and Longman
Keystone (grades 6-12), whose goals are to:
- accelerate academic
achievement through explicit instruction in reading, listening,
speaking, and writing,
- develop transferable
cross-curricular academic
skills through connected learning opportunities, and
- provide both
teachers and students with an easy-to-use roadmap to academic success.
This month, I wanted to bring you up to date on who is using Cornerstone and
Keystone.
Pearson Longman is pleased to announce two major state adoptions:
- The California Department of
Education has adopted Longman Keystone for Reading Intervention
(Program 4) and Reading Intervention for English Learners (Program 5)
for grades 4-8.
- The Florida Department of
Education has adopted Longman Cornerstone (elementary ESOL), Longman
Keystone (English/Language Arts through ESOL), and Longman Keys to
Learning (Developmental English through ESOL).
